Union Minister for Fisheries, Animal Husbandry & Dairying and Panchayati Raj, Rajiv Ranjan Singh, on Tuesday launched fisheries infrastructure projects worth Rs 36.49 crore in Kamarajar Manimadapam, Puducherry, to strengthen fisheries infrastructure, promote sustainable livelihood opportunities for coastal communities, enhance value chain efficiencies and accelerate development through a cooperative-led approach.
